This chapter looks at the subject of corporate data modelling and sees how it differs from project- or business-area-level data modelling. It introduces and discusses three approaches to the development of a corporate data model and six principles of corporate data modelling.
WHY DEVELOP A CORPORATE DATA MODEL?
In many respects a corporate data model is similar to the project-level conceptual data model we encountered in Chapter 2. It comprises definitions of the things of significant interest to the business (the entity types), definitions of what we need to know about those things (the attributes) and the associations between them (the relationships).
